"Eleescape" is a non-contaminating, sustainable static electricity prevention sheet developed for transport trays that require ESD protection, used for LCD-related components, optical components, and various electronic parts. Unlike conventional static prevention methods, it does not use carbon or surfactants, and it features a new packaging material with clean and stable static electricity dissipation properties. Additionally, it has excellent abrasion resistance, which helps reduce debris generation from component contact. 【Features】 ■ No carbon or surfactants used ■ Protects components from static electricity damage ■ Solves debris generation from trays ■ No change in static prevention performance after repeated washing ■ Can be used multiple times *For more details, please refer to the related links or feel free to contact us.

【Other Features】 ■ The surface resistance value exhibits stable electrostatic dissipation performance and attenuation characteristics in the range of 10^9 to 10^11 Ω. ■ Excellent wear resistance reduces the generation of tray debris due to component contact. 【Usage】 ■ LCD module transport tray ■ Smartphone and camera module transport tray ■ Ceramic package transport tray ■ LED module transport tray *For more details, please refer to the related links or feel free to contact us.
